What are Produce Associates?

Produce Associates are retail employees who specialize in handling, displaying, and maintaining fresh fruits and vegetables in grocery stores or supermarkets. Their responsibilities include stocking produce shelves, ensuring product freshness, rotating inventory, and assisting customers with selection or questions about produce items. They also help maintain cleanliness and organization within the produce section, contributing to a positive shopping experience for customers.

What Is a Produce Associate?

A produce associate sets up produce displays in a grocery store. As a produce associate, one of your primary duties is to provide customer service to all patrons by helping them to pick out or find specific types of produce. Your other responsibilities include arranging fruits and vegetables neatly, maintaining a clean workplace, and tracking inventory. Qualifications for the job include a familiarity with the produce in the area and customer service experience.

What are some common challenges a Produce Associate faces and how can they be successfully managed?

Produce Associates often face challenges such as maintaining the freshness of fruits and vegetables, managing inventory to reduce waste, and ensuring appealing displays. To succeed, it's important to regularly rotate stock, promptly remove spoiled items, and follow proper storage guidelines. Collaborating with team members and staying attentive to customer needs also helps maintain high standards and a positive shopping experience.

Job Title: Produce Associate Location: Retail Grocery Location

Position OverviewThe produce associate is responsible for increasing customer confidence and loyalty by providing courteous and prompt service, consistent operating conditions and a friendly atmosphere. Primary Responsibilities & Accountabilities
  • Provide continuous attention to customer needs; greet, assist and thank customers in a prompt, courteous and friendly manner.
  • Offer product suggestions when appropriate.
  • Stock and rotate department products to ensure freshness and date control; restock and use supply items efficiently to eliminate waste and to maintain the lowest supply cost.
  • Operate department equipment and tools.
  • Keep work area clean, orderly and free from safety hazards; report faulty equipment and hazards to management.
  • Notify management of team member theft, customer shoplifting, unauthorized mark-downs, property defacement or any action that is illegal and/or against company policy.
  • Perform other job-related duties as assigned
QualificationsMinimum
  • Must be 18 years of age.
  • Ability to read, write and speak English proficiently.
  • Ability to understand and follow English instructions.
  • Authorization to work in the United States or the ability to obtain the same.
  • Successful completion of pre-employment drug testing and background check.
